1. Reduce Television Watching
– People love relaxing and doing nothing while watching the television,
myself included more frequently than I’d like. The issue is staring at
the TV doesn’t utilize your mental capacity. It’s similar to having the
energy sapped out of a muscle without the health benefits of exercise.
Don’t you feel drained after a couple hours of watching TV? Your eyes
are sore and tired from being focused on the light box for so long. You
don’t even have the energy to read a book. When you feel like relaxing,
try reading a book instead. In case you’re too tired, listen to some
cool music. When you’re with your friends or family, leave the tube off
and have a conversation. These things utilize your brain more than TV
and allow you to relax. However you can watch discoveries,
documentaries, crime detective & some IQ movies.
2. Exercise–
I used to think that I’d learn more by not exercising and utilizing the
time to read a book instead. However, I understood that time spent
practicing always leads to greater learning because it improves working
well and getting a lot done during the time afterwards. Using your body
clears your head and creates a wave of energy. A while later, you’ll
feel refreshed and can think straight or concentrate more easily.
3. Read Challenging Books–
Numerous individuals like to read prominent suspense fiction, however
generally these books are not mentally stimulating. If you want to
enhance your thinking and writing ability you should read books that
make you focus. Reading a classic novel can change your perspective or
view of the world and will make you think in more exact, rich and
beautiful English. Try not to be reluctant to look up a word if you
don’t know it, and don’t be afraid of dense passages. Take as much time
as required, re-read when necessary and you’ll soon grow comfortable
with the author’s style. When you adapt to reading challenging books,
you’ll find it easier to understand a wide range of works. The challenge
of adapting new thoughts or learning new ideas is far more interesting –
inspiring than any tacky tension-thriller.
4. Early to Bed, Early to Rise
–Nothing makes it harder to focus than lack of sleep. You’ll be most
made young again if you go to bed early and don’t sleep more than 8
hours. If you stay up late and repay by sleeping late, you’ll wake up
tired and experience difficulty focusing. In my experience the early
morning hours are the most peaceful and beneficial – productive.
Awakening early gives you more productive hours and maximizes your
mental sharpness throughout the day. If you have the opportunity, take
10-20 minute naps when you are hit with a wave of sleepiness or
tiredness. Anything longer will make you tired, but a short nap will
revive you.
